FRT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

397 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Federal Realty Investment Trust (FRT)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$8.92B — up 18% from $7.54B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 127 funds opened new FRT positions and 66 closed out — a net gain of 61 holders — while 121 added to existing stakes and 106 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.49B. The largest seller was Zimmer Partners, exiting entirely with an estimated $112M sold.
